Former Wimbledon champion admits use of steroids
Sunday 05, Sep 2010
The former Wimbledon champion and tennis great, John McEnroe, has unwittingly admitted that he used steroids for a period of six years.
This steroid admission followed a similar admission by Greg Rusedski that he tested positive for the banned steroid, nandrolone.
From News.bbc.co.uk:
“I was being given a form of legal steroid they gave to horses until they decided it was too strong even for them,” said McEnroe.
“I’m not sure some of the strong, anti-inflammatory drugs are that far removed from illegal ones.”
McEnroe added: “People have to become more aware of what they are putting into their bodies.
People are generally administered drugs too readily, McEnroe said.
